Summary "Lovers Arturo Cova and Alicia escape society in search of their freedom. But Alicia's rapture will take Arturo on a journey through "green hell" of the Amazon rainforest. This poet from Bogota immerses himself in a desolate, unpredictable pilgrimage into the roots of nature and life. Through his journey, Rivera subtly introduces the reader to the ghosts of time and the hidden fibers that make up the human condition. Rubber fever, exploitation, violence, and madness are all explored in this Colombian classic set at the beginning of the 1900's. However, this novel is not only a literary masterpiece, it is also a heavy social critique and political commentary, delicately wrapped in sensible prose"-- Provided by publisher
